Infrastructure officials detail Ontario Science Centre structural issues

Ontario infrastructure officials are further justifying their decision to close the Ontario Science Centre by releasing more details today on the issues with the building beyond its roof. TORONTO - The Ontario Science Centre building is facing critical issues not just with its roof, but with heating, sprinkler and electrical systems, officials said Thursday 鈥 but they did not say what they plan to do about it, if anything.

The focus right now, following the abrupt closure of the facility in northeast Toronto last month, is on doing more investigative work and moving all exhibits and staff out of the building before the winter, when the possibility of snow on the roof creates an additional risk, Infrastructure Minister Kinga Surma said at a news conference.
